For the 2025-26 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 391 students in Heber Springs School District. This district's average middle testing ranking is 10/10, which is in the top 5% of public middle schools in Arkansas.
Public Middle School in Heber Springs School District have an average math proficiency score of 55% (versus the Arkansas public middle school average of 37%), and reading proficiency score of 57% (versus the 42%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 11%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Arkansas public middle school average of 41% (majority Black).

Heber Springs School District, which is ranked within the top 10% of all 257 school districts in Arkansas (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 92% has increased from 80-84%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$11,913 in this school district is less than the state median of $13,133.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$10,289 is less than the state median of $13,044.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
